Sanctuary Park Rescue's Adoption Policy
All potential adopters are required to complete a detailed adoption application. Applications are reviewed to ensure the dog is a good match for the adopter’s lifestyle, experience level, home environment, and other pets.
We conduct reference checks, including veterinary references (if applicable), and verify that current and past pets are up to date on vaccinations and heartworm prevention. Landlord approval is required for renters. A home check (virtual or in-person) may be conducted when appropriate.
Adopters must agree to provide proper veterinary care, keep the dog as an indoor companion, maintain heartworm prevention, and return the dog to Sanctuary Park Rescue if they are ever unable to keep the animal. All adoptions require a signed adoption contract and an adoption fee to help offset medical expenses.
Our goal is to ensure safe, responsible, and permanent placements that prioritize the long-term wellbeing of each dog.
